Last week, our Reading Challenge entered an exciting new phase with Week 3 – The Golden Word Hunt, a literacy initiative designed to stretch vocabulary, deepen comprehension, and inspire students to explore language beyond the ordinary.

Powered by our newly launched Mobile Library, students enthusiastically selected novels and embarked on a mission to uncover Tier 3 vocabulary words — specialised, sophisticated words that challenged them to think, research, and communicate at a higher level. 🧠

To complete the challenge, students identified advanced vocabulary, researched accurate meanings, and demonstrated true understanding by crafting rich, high-level sentences that reflected both creativity and mastery of language.

The excitement built throughout the week and reached its peak during the evaluation session held on Friday, where students confidently showcased their vocabulary knowledge and literacy skills before their peers.

After an impressive display of excellence, four students emerged as standout performers:

As part of the ongoing Green School Programme themed “Education for a Sustainable Environment,” selected students of Caleb British International School embarked on an enlightening educational excursion to Pan-Atlantic University and Eleko Beach on Saturday, 16th May 2026 for the pilot launch of the National Ocean Microplastics Monitoring Initiative (NOMMI).

The excursion, organised by RE-cycleME Solutions in collaboration with the Living Green Club of Pan-Atlantic University, exposed students to practical environmental research, sustainability education, and marine conservation activities. 🌱🌊

From engaging keynote sessions and sustainability talks to practical field sampling exercises at Eleko Beach, students gained firsthand experience in environmental documentation, waste classification, teamwork, and scientific research techniques. The experience opened their eyes to the growing impact of ocean pollution and the urgent need to protect our environment for future generations. ♻️

One of the most inspiring moments of the excursion was watching our students confidently participate in discussions, ask brilliant questions, and actively engage in field activities alongside environmental experts and researchers.

The students also enjoyed a guided tour of Pan-Atlantic University, further enriching the learning experience beyond the classroom walls.

Last week, our Year 8 and Year 9 students participated in a powerful and inspiring Anti-Bullying Programme themed “Kindness Matters.”

The atmosphere was filled with reflection, creativity, learning, and meaningful conversations as students explored the importance of empathy, respect, compassion, and standing up for one another. 🤝

A major highlight of the programme was the engaging playlet presented by Year 8 students, which beautifully portrayed the effects of bullying and the life-changing impact of kindness. The performance captured hearts, sparked reflection, and reminded students that even the smallest act of kindness can make a big difference.

Students also participated in the Kindness Pledge and World Kindness Prayer, reaffirming their commitment to creating a safe, supportive, and inclusive school environment. An educational video session further deepened their understanding of bullying and the importance of being an upstander rather than a bystander.

To keep the message alive beyond the programme, students were introduced to a Kindness Challenge for the week, encouraging daily acts of kindness within the school community. Committee members were also tasked with preparing creative presentations on “Being an Upstander, Not a Bystander,” which will be shared during fellowship sessions.

🏅 A Celebration of Excellence at CBIS 🏅

Thursday was truly a remarkable and heartwarming day at CBIS as we celebrated our brilliant students during the Accolade Assembly for Academics.

The atmosphere was filled with pride, joy, applause, and unforgettable smiles as students were recognised for their outstanding academic achievements. Students who scored 90% and above were honoured with Gold Ties, while those who achieved 80% – 89% were decorated with Red Ties in recognition of their dedication, resilience, and commitment to excellence. ❤️💛

The presence of proud parents and guardians added warmth and beauty to the occasion as they watched their children shine with confidence and honour. It was a truly inspiring moment for the entire CBIS community.

Beyond the awards and decorations, the assembly served as a powerful reminder that hard work, consistency, and determination always produce rewarding results.
